This subcontract, managed by the Maritime Supply Chain under the Department of Defense, requires the supply of 11 fluid assembly filters for prime contractors on procurement projects. The selected provider is responsible for manufacturing or sourcing the filters and must ensure all marking for shipment and storage adheres to MIL-STD-129, while hazardous material labeling must comply with 29 CFR 1910.1200. To be eligible, the contractor must possess a valid CAGE code and Unique Entity Identifier. The opportunity is designated as a Total Small Business Set-Aside under NAICS code 332999, with performance taking place in New Cumberland, Pennsylvania. Interested parties must submit their responses by September 8, 2026.
